An Austrian Commission Document To Major General Peter Blazic GTRexclude rosette on the ribbonAn Austrian Commission Document to Major General Peter Blazic Printed in black ink on a thick white paper stock, text in German, declaring that Peter Blazic had been promoted to the rank of "Generalmajors" (Major General) in the Austrian Army, dated June 20, 1908 at Vienna, signature in black ink below the text, large embossed Austrian coat of arms and "J. Whatman 1907 England" watermark at the bottom centre, signed by the Minister of War in black ink
